Creating Your First Gemini Sticker: A Step-by-Step Tutorial

Transforming a creative thought into a functional sticker requires more than just a vague description. It requires a specific prompting strategy.

Step 1: Accessing the Image Generation Feature

Open the Gemini web interface or the mobile app. Ensure you are using a version that supports image generation (available in most regions for English-language prompts).

Step 2: Crafting the Perfect Sticker Prompt

A common mistake is asking for an image without specifying the "sticker" format. To get a result that is easy to cut out or use digitally, your prompt should include structural keywords.

The Formula for Success: [Subject] + [Action/Pose] + [Artistic Style] + [Sticker Technical Specs]

Example Prompt:

"Generate a sticker of a cute ginger cat wearing sunglasses and drinking a latte. Use a 3D Pixar-style aesthetic. The image should have a bold white outline, a plain white background, and high contrast."

Step 3: Refinement and Variation

Gemini will usually provide a few variations. Look for the one with the cleanest edges. If the AI adds a complex background, you can follow up with: "Remove the background elements and keep only the cat with a thick white border."

Essential Prompting Keywords for Different Sticker Styles

To achieve a specific "vibe," you need to use the language of artists and designers. Here are several categories of prompts that work exceptionally well with Gemini.

The Kawaii Aesthetic

Popular in Japanese culture, this style focuses on cuteness, oversized eyes, and pastel colors.

  • Keywords: Kawaii, chibi, pastel palette, rounded edges, simple features, adorable.
  • Sample Prompt: "A kawaii-style sticker of a smiling strawberry with tiny hands, vector art, soft pink outlines, white background."

The Retro 70s Look

This style is making a huge comeback in the zodiac sticker market.

  • Keywords: Psychedelic, groovy, sunset colors (orange, yellow, brown), thick groovy typography, vintage feel.
  • Sample Prompt: "A retro 1970s style sticker featuring the Gemini twins symbol, groovy sunset color palette, thick cream-colored border, flat design."

The 3D Render (Pixar/Disney Style)

These stickers pop off the screen and look like high-end merchandise.

  • Keywords: 3D render, octane render, soft studio lighting, vibrant colors, expressive facial features, claymation.
  • Sample Prompt: "A 3D render sticker of a playful golden retriever puppy, Pixar style, high detail fur, glossy finish, white background, bold die-cut outline."

The Minimalist Line Art

Perfect for professional branding or elegant laptop decals.

  • Keywords: Minimalist, single line art, black and white, elegant, geometric, vector.
  • Sample Prompt: "A minimalist line art sticker of the Gemini constellation, thin black lines on a white background, circular frame, clean aesthetic."

For iOS Users (The Quick Lift Method)

Apple introduced a feature in iOS 16 that is a game-changer for sticker creators.

  1. Save the image generated by Gemini to your Photos app.
  2. Open the photo and long-press on the subject.
  3. The iPhone will "shimmer" around the edges of the subject.
  4. Select "Add Sticker." This automatically removes the background and adds it to your sticker drawer for use in iMessage and supported third-party apps.

For Android and Multi-Platform Users (WhatsApp/Telegram)

To get your Gemini creations into WhatsApp, you might need a "Sticker Maker" app.

  1. Download a reputable sticker maker app from the Play Store.
  2. Upload the image you saved from Gemini.
  3. Use the app’s "auto-cut" feature. Since you prompted Gemini for a "white background" and "bold outline," the auto-cut tool will work flawlessly.
  4. Export the pack to WhatsApp.

Preparing for Physical Printing

If you intend to print your Gemini stickers via a service like StickerMule or at home using a Cricut machine:

  • Resolution: Ensure you download the highest resolution version from Gemini.
  • DPI: Use a photo editor (like Canva or Photoshop) to ensure the image is set to 300 DPI for crisp printing.
  • Bleed Area: When using a cutting machine, ensure the white outline is wide enough so the blade doesn't cut into the actual design.

Exploring the Gemini Zodiac Sticker Market

If you aren't interested in creating your own, the market for pre-made Gemini zodiac stickers is vast and culturally rich. Gemini, being an air sign ruled by Mercury, is often associated with duality, communication, and intellect.

Popular Design Themes for Gemini

  • The Twins: Often depicted as two faces looking in opposite directions or two distinct figures. Modern interpretations sometimes use a "Good/Evil" or "Sun/Moon" duality.
  • The Symbol (♊︎): This Roman numeral II is frequently incorporated into tattoo-style stickers or minimalist decals.
  • The Constellation: A more subtle way to show zodiac pride, often rendered in holographic or "glow in the dark" materials.
  • Personality Quotes: "Gemini: I’m not two-faced, I’m twice the fun" or "Gemini: Talkative, Curious, and Adaptable."

Where to Buy High-Quality Gemini Stickers

When browsing platforms like Etsy or Redbubble, look for the following quality indicators:

  • Material: Vinyl is the standard for durability. If you want it for a water bottle, ensure it is labeled "Dishwasher Safe" or "Waterproof."
  • Finish: Matte finishes look more sophisticated and are better for journals, while glossy or holographic finishes are great for laptops.
  • Artist Reputation: Check reviews specifically for "sticker thickness" and "color accuracy."

Common Challenges and How to Solve Them

Even with advanced AI, you might encounter some hurdles. Here is how to navigate them.

Problem: The AI Includes Text that is Gibberish

AI models sometimes struggle with specific text inside images.

  • Solution: Generate the image without text first. Then, use a tool like Canva or even Instagram Stories to overlay the desired text in a clean font.

Problem: The Subject is "Cut Off" at the Edges

Sometimes Gemini renders the subject too close to the frame, meaning you lose the edge of a hat or a tail.

  • Solution: Add "wide shot" or "ensure the entire subject is centered with plenty of space around the edges" to your prompt.

Problem: The Style is Too Realistic

Stickers usually look better when they are slightly stylized or "flat."

  • Solution: Specifically avoid terms like "photorealistic" or "hyper-realistic." Instead, use "vector," "illustration," "flat design," or "decal style."

Frequently Asked Questions About Gemini Stickers

Is it legal to sell stickers I make with Gemini?

Google’s terms of service regarding AI-generated images are evolving. Generally, you own the output you create, but you should check the latest commercial usage rights in your specific region, especially if you plan to sell them on platforms like Etsy.

Can Gemini create stickers with my own face?

Yes, if you upload a reference photo of yourself and ask Gemini to "transform this photo into a cute 3D sticker," it can generate a character based on your likeness. However, ensure you have the rights to any photos you upload.

What is the best size for a digital sticker?

Most messaging apps prefer a square ratio (1:1), typically around 512x512 pixels. Gemini defaults to high-resolution squares, which is perfect.

Does Gemini support transparent backgrounds?

Currently, Gemini generates images with solid backgrounds (usually white if prompted). You will need to use a "background remover" tool or the iOS "lift subject" feature to make the background truly transparent (PNG format) for digital use.
